They manifest as foul, cyclopean beings of rotten flesh who are surrounded by swarms of flies. Each Plaguebearer counts the untold diseases and plagues of Nurgle in monotonous chants.<sup>3a</sup> Mortals who listen to these cursed chants can fall ill.<sup>2</sup>
Despite their sickly appearance, Plaguebearers pose a lethal threat to anyone they encounter since their otherworldly toughness allows them to endure most attacks with ease. <sup>3a</sup>
A notable source of Plague Bearers is the [[Daemon World of Bubonicus]] <sup>1</sup>
